  2. Duplicating the success MLP has had with the brony fans will likely not work if they go in with the mindset of "How can we get the young adult male audience"

    Because the typical things the corporate workers at Hasbro will probably think will get the young adult male audience (pop culture references, hidden sex jokes, totally radical characters who use boss slang) aren't what made MLP popular with that audience. MLP became popular because the show had solid characters, had innocent optimistic humor, and above all was very sincere. You can't duplicate sincerity

  3. It seems like technology is inconsistent. Out of show context is that writers and animators throw in whatever based on what helps the story, makes an interesting visual, or makes a joke. In show explanation can be that they are in a period of rapid development but without rapid implementation. Technology seems far more advanced in the first season where there seemed to be few modern items and even trains ran on horse power. Second season we are seeing alot more technology but things like video games are still public, you aren't seeing alot in the home. My thinking is that through magic ponies can make and run high tech items but there is not enough manufacturing or infrastructure to bring it to the average pony. Twilight has some advance scientific gear but she is Celestia's personal student so she is an exception. Most advanced items are for use of the public or something that is expensive and rare like the cider machine

  7. From what I've seen most call centers are strict on attendance and being late due to the nature of the job requiring being able to estimate how many calls can be handled. A worker not being there throws this off. When I worked in a call center I kept calling in so I could pick up extra shifts at my main job and was told I would be fired if I kept it up. Your being fired probably came from above your immediate supervisors and they probably had no say in it.

    The best thing is to learn from what happened and if your supervisors think you are a good worker see if they will give you a reference
